Output 77631e98c8ab52ea5d89d1a9c7b41c80ae25e0b1d6fa614f235ed00f0cb68ab2:2

value
86452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0143eb630b5bd8bfb0af02014783233b265264 OP_EQUAL
address
3MqamrTj9jx2sYjfvVFHoB2oqFFVhTVmAk
transaction
77631e98c8ab52ea5d89d1a9c7b41c80ae25e0b1d6fa614f235ed00f0cb68ab2
spent
true